NAME
   Apache2::WebApp::Plugin::Validate - Plugin providing data validation
   methods

SYNOPSIS
     my $result = $c->plugin('Validate')->method( ... );     # Apache2::WebApp::Plugin::Validate->method()

DESCRIPTION
   Common methods used for validating user input.

PREREQUISITES
   This package is part of a larger distribution and was NOT intended to be
   used directly. In order for this plugin to work properly, the following
   packages must be installed:

     Apache2::WebApp
     Date::Calc
     Data::Validate::URI
     Email::Valid
     HTTP::BrowserDetect
     Net::DNS::Check
     Params::Validate

OBJECT METHODS
 browser
   Check if the request is from a browser.

     my $result = $c->plugin('Validate')->browser();

 currency
   Check the currency format (0.00)

     my $result = $c->plugin('Validate')->currency($total);

 date
   Check the date format (YYYY-MM-DD)

     my $result = $c->plugin('Validate')->date($date);

 date_is_future
   Is the date in the future? (YYYY-MM-DD)

     my $result = $c->plugin('Validate')->date_is_future($date);

 date_is_past
   Is the date in the past? (YYYY-MM-DD)

     my $result = $c->plugin('Validate')->date_is_past($date);

 domain
   Check the domain name format; verify the domain status using a DNS
   query.

     my $result = $c->plugin('Validate')->domain($name);

 email
   Check the e-mail address format; verify the domain status using a DNS
   query.

     my $result = $c->plugin('Validate')->email( $address, $mx_check );

 integer
   Check for a integer.

     my $result = $c->plugin('Validate')->integer($value);

 html
   Check for HTML markup.

     my $result = $c->plugin('Validate')->html($markup);

 url
   Check the URL.

     my $result = $c->plugin('Validate')->url($string);
